Reflections (Minute Poem)



The Night expertly reveals Self.
Thoughts on a shelf,
Uncovered light,
Exposed in sight.

However one would try to hide,
The truth inside
Will echo strong
What's right or wrong.

And like the Day that we must face
We can't erase
To change we must
Learn from the Past.

The Minute Poem is a poem that follows the '8,4,4,4' syllable count structure. It usually has 3 stanzas that are exactly the same. So: 8,4,4,4; 8,4,4,4; 8,4,4,4 syllables.

A traditional Minute Poem has 12 lines total. It has 60 syllables. It is written in a strict iambic meter. The rhyme scheme is as follows: aabb, ccdd, eeff.
